After searching and comparing prices I went to Ted's Tire Discounter and ended up getting Cooper Discoverer M+S for $930. $130 of this is tax (what a rip off, different thread though). The owner said a local airport shuttle company uses the M+S all year round and get up to 100,000 km.
I priced out Silent Armours from him $1200. Canadian Tire's prices on Silent Armour $1200, BFG All Terain $1200. Dettmer Tire's prices on Laredo's $1050, Transforce $1100. If I could have waited for Canadian Tire's 2nd tire half off sale I would have and went for the Silent Armours.
Walamrt had Goodyear Authority's for $900 but they are more of an off road tire. I didn't get the best but it looks like Coopers are tires. Thanks again for your input.
